Yo, you heard about Puff La Carts? They be havin' the buzz right now. Tons of people hittin' up these carts for real. But is it all hype? Are Puff La Carts actually on point? Or are they just {another gimmick? We're https://mariamwosi139276.thezenweb.com/puff-la-carts-fact-or-fiction-75558865